Enhancing Financial Analysis with Data APIs
Last updated February 19, 2024
Introduction:
Financial analysis is a cornerstone of informed decision-making for individuals, businesses, and investors. Traditionally, conducting thorough financial analysis involved manual data collection, analysis, and reporting. However, with the advent of Data Application Programming Interfaces (APIs), accessing and analyzing financial data has become more efficient, accurate, and insightful. In this article, we'll explore how leveraging Data APIs can enhance financial analysis, unlock valuable insights, and drive strategic decision-making.
Enhancing Financial Analysis with Data APIs:
- Identify Analysis Objectives:
- Define the specific objectives and questions you aim to address through financial analysis.
- Determine the key metrics, indicators, and data points relevant to your analysis goals.
- Explore Data APIs:
- Research and identify Data APIs that offer access to financial data sources, such as market data, company financials, economic indicators, and demographic information.
- Consider factors such as data coverage, reliability, timeliness, and API documentation quality when evaluating Data APIs.
- Obtain API Access:
- Sign up for developer accounts or obtain API keys from the chosen Data API providers.
- Follow authentication procedures (e.g., API keys, OAuth) to authenticate your applications and access data securely.
- Retrieve Financial Data:
- Utilize API endpoints to retrieve relevant financial data sets, such as stock prices, balance sheets, income statements, economic indicators, or industry benchmarks.
- Specify parameters such as date ranges, ticker symbols, geographical regions, or financial metrics to tailor data retrieval to your analysis needs.
- Cleanse and Transform Data:
- Cleanse and preprocess raw data obtained from Data APIs to address missing values, outliers, or data inconsistencies.
- Transform data into a standardized format or structure suitable for analysis, such as tabular data frames or time series datasets.
- Perform Analysis:
- Apply statistical analysis, financial modeling techniques, and data visualization methods to analyze the retrieved financial data.
- Calculate key performance indicators (KPIs), financial ratios, trend analysis, correlation analysis, and comparative benchmarking to gain insights into financial trends and patterns.
- Visualize Insights:
- Visualize analysis results and insights using charts, graphs, dashboards, and interactive visualizations.
- Choose visualization techniques that effectively communicate complex financial concepts and trends to stakeholders, such as line charts, bar charts, scatter plots, and heat maps.
- Interpret Results:
- Interpret analysis results in the context of your analysis objectives, business goals, and industry trends.
- Identify actionable insights, potential risks, and opportunities for strategic decision-making based on analysis findings.
- Iterate and Refine:
- Continuously iterate on your financial analysis process, incorporating feedback, refining analysis techniques, and exploring additional data sources or metrics.
- Stay informed about updates and enhancements to Data APIs, leveraging new features or datasets to enhance your analysis capabilities.
Conclusion:
Data APIs offer a wealth of financial data and insights that can significantly enhance the quality and depth of financial analysis. By leveraging Data APIs effectively, organizations and individuals can gain a competitive edge, make more informed decisions, and navigate the complexities of the financial landscape with confidence. Whether you're a financial analyst, investor, or business leader, harnessing the power of Data APIs can unlock valuable insights and drive success in today's dynamic financial environment.